Understanding Adjustment of Status and Its Complexities

Adjustment of Status is the method by which an individual shifts their immigration status from a short-term or undocumented classification to that of a lawful permanent resident. It may sound like a single step, but it actually includes multiple forms, required records, medical examinations, background investigations, and in many cases an in-person appointment. Each of these phases carries its own set of rules, and omitting even a small detail can cause delays or complete rejections.

How an Attorney Helps You Avoid Costly Mistakes

Among the most compelling reasons to engage an attorney is the staggering quantity of paperwork required. Form I-485, the principal form for Adjustment of Status, is merely the starting point. Depending on your individual circumstances, you may also need to prepare Form I-130, Form I-864, employment authorization paperwork, and travel permits — each with precise instructions and evidence requirements. An skilled attorney recognizes exactly which documents pertain to your distinct circumstances and the proper way to prepare them correctly the first time.

Mistakes on immigration applications are not small hassles. A erroneous answer, a overlooked sign-off, or an incomplete part can cause a Request for Evidence from USCIS, which tacks on a lengthy period to your timeline. In more critical situations, conflicting details or blunders could draw attention that result in further investigation or even accusations of misrepresentation. An attorney reviews every piece of information before submittal, dramatically reducing the likelihood of these problems.

More than paperwork, attorneys are familiar with the legal nuances that most applicants simply aren’t familiar with. For example, certain past immigration offenses, criminal records, or prior deportation orders can produce bars to eligibility that aren’t necessarily obvious. A knowledgeable lawyer can review your past honestly and assist you recognize whether a waiver is obtainable or if an different path would better serve your goals.
